Gut Metabolomics Analysis Service

    Gut metabolomics refers to the analysis of terminal and intermediate metabolites generated by specific metabolic processes occurring within the gut. These metabolites are critical in maintaining immune-metabolic homeostasis, facilitating mutualistic interactions between the host and microbiota, and providing defense against pathogenic organisms. The primary sources of these metabolites are dietary inputs and microbial metabolic activities. These metabolites fulfill essential physiological roles, including regulation of fat storage, glucose metabolism, immune modulation, and endocrine function. Additionally, gut metabolites not only influence local gut barrier integrity and mucosal immune equilibrium but can also traverse the intestinal epithelium via active or passive transport, exerting regulatory effects on extraintestinal tissues.

     

    Key metabolites such as short-chain fatty acids (SCFAs), trimethylamine N-oxide (TMAO), choline, conjugated linoleic acid, secondary bile acids, and phenolic compounds are derived from dietary components or synthesized by gut microbes through various metabolic pathways. The production of these metabolites is shaped by dietary nutrients and bioactive compounds like phytochemicals. Research has increasingly demonstrated that alterations in gut metabolite profiles are strongly linked to the pathogenesis of chronic metabolic disorders, including obesity and type 2 diabetes. As a result, comprehensive analysis of gut metabolites not only advances our understanding of disease mechanisms but also presents novel therapeutic targets for personalized medicine approaches.
